Do you need a bunch of coins to really use the Coinbase Wallet extension? Or is it good for beginners who have small amounts of crypto?

Dude, you totally don't need a bunch of crypto to use the Coinbase Wallet extension. When I first tried it, I literally had like ten bucks worth of ETH, just messing around to see how it worked. The cool part is, you can connect to dapps, look at NFTs, and check out DeFi projects with just a small amount. It's not just for whales (people with tons of coins), and actually, I think it's way less scary to learn when you only have a little on the line.

Also, it's good to get used to how the wallet works before you go crazy investing in coins. Since you hold your own private keys with this wallet, you're in control, which is awesome, but you gotta remember your recovery phrase – I've lost mine before and it was a nightmare. So yeah, it's great for beginners and you don't have to be rich to try it out. Just start small and learn before putting in anything big. That's what I did, and I felt way better about messing with crypto after that.
